how long is hamnet

The novel Hamnet by Maggie O’Farrell is approximately 320 pages long in most standard paperback editions, and the unabridged audiobook runs about 12 hours and 40+ minutes.
Basic details
- Print length: Around 320 pages in commonly available English-language editions.
- Audiobook length: About 12 hours 42 minutes for the full, unabridged recording.
- Publication year: First published in 2020, now widely available in paperback and audio formats.

Extra context
Hamnet is a historical fiction novel about Shakespeare’s family and the death of his son Hamnet, which the book imagines as a key emotional backdrop to the later writing of Hamlet.
